1. Checking the obvious: 5 simple reasons that 90% of users miss

Before disassembling the refrigerator or calling service, eliminate the “human factor”. These problems do not require repair, but they are to blame in half of the cases when the freezer stops working:

  • 🔌 Lack of power. Check if the indicator on the panel is lit. Perhaps the circuit breaker in the control panel has tripped or the plug has come off the socket (especially important for models Samsung RB37J5240SA with sensitive electronics).
  • ❄️ Vacation or Eco mode. In some refrigerators (for example LG GA-B489YQZL), these functions turn off the freezer to save energy. Look at the instructions - the path to the menu may differ.
  • 🚪 Door is not tightly closed. Even a gap of 2 mm leads to freezing of the seal and failure of the sensors. Carry out a test with a sheet of paper: if it falls out when the door is closed, the seal requires replacement.
  • 🌡️ Incorrect temperature settings. In two-compressor models (Bosch KGE39XW2AR), the freezer and refrigerator compartment are regulated separately. Make sure that the thermostat is not set to “0” or “Minimum”.
  • 🧊 Overload with food. If you fill the freezer to capacity, air circulation is disrupted. In refrigerators No Frost (for example, Indesit ITF 118 W) this leads to icing of the fan and the system stops.

Simple test: unplug the refrigerator for 10 minutes, then turn it on again. If after 2-3 hours the freezer began to cool, the problem was a temporary failure of the control board. If not, read on.

⚠️ Attention: In refrigerators with inverter compressor (Samsung RB34T602CSR, LG GB-B459SLQZ) after a reboot, protection may work. Wait 5-7 minutes before turning it on again, otherwise you risk burning the motor.

2. A clogged capillary tube: how to diagnose and fix it without a technician

The capillary tube is the “aorta” of the refrigerator: freon circulates through it between the compressor and the evaporator. If it becomes clogged (for example, due to oil decomposition or moisture ingress), the freezer stops freezingand the refrigerator compartment can continue to operate. Signs of a blockage:

  • 🔊 The compressor runs non-stop, but does not turn off.
  • ❄️ The condenser (grid at the back) is cold, although it should heat up.
  • 🕒 The temperature in the freezer rises to +5...+10°C in 6–12 hours.

For diagnostics:

  1. Disconnect the refrigerator and move it away from the wall.
  2. Find the capillary tube (thin copper tube running from the compressor to evaporator).
  3. Gently touch it with your hand: if one part is hot and the other is icy it is 100% clogged.

Solution:

  1. Blow out the tube with a compressed with air (use a compressor for tires with a pressure of no more than 6 atm).
  2. If this does not help, you will need replacement capillary or flushing the system freon R134a (for models before 2010) or R600a (for modern ones).

3. Failure of the thermostat or temperature sensor: how to check

The thermostat (in mechanical models) or temperature sensor (in electronic models) is the “brain” that tells the compressor when to turn on. If it breaks the compressor either does not start, or runs idle. How to check:

Refrigerator type Symptoms of malfunction How to diagnose
Mechanical (with adjustment wheel) The compressor does not turn on at all, the light inside is on Ring with a multimeter in resistance mode. Normal: 0 Ohm in the “Off” position, 1–10 Ohm when turning the knob
Electronic (with display) There is an error on the display E1, F2 or the temperature indicator is flashing Check the sensor resistance: at +20°C it should be ~5–7 kOhm (for Samsung and LG)
No Frost (with fan) The fan does not rotate, but the compressor hums Check the power supply to the defrost sensor (usually 12–24 V)

To replace the thermostat in mechanical models (Atlant MXM 1705-80, Biryusa 145):

  1. Remove the temperature control knob (pry it with a screwdriver).
  2. Unscrew the protective panel inside the chamber.
  3. Disconnect the wires from the thermostat (take a photo of the connection diagram!).
  4. Install a new thermostat (cost: 800–1500 rubles for most brands).

In electronic refrigerators (Samsung RL38T671CS8, LG GA-B429SLGL), the sensor is usually located on the evaporator. You will have to remove it for access. the inside panel of the freezer is more complicated, and without experience it is better not to take risks.

4. Problems with the compressor: when you can’t do without a technician

The compressor is the heart of the refrigerator. If it is broken, the freezer won't work, and the refrigerator compartment (in single-compressor models) will also start to heat up:

  • 🔇 The compressor does not turn on at all (no hum, vibration).
  • 🔥 The compressor body is hot (more than +80°C).
  • 💥 The protection is activated 5–10 seconds after start (click and shutdown).
  • 🛢️ Oil leaks are visible on the compressor housing (freon leakage).

Self-diagnosis:

  1. Turn off the refrigerator and wait until the compressor cools down (1-2 hours).
  2. Remove the protective casing from the back wall.
  3. Test the compressor windings with a multimeter:
    • Resistance between terminals C (common) and S (starting): 20–40 Ohm.
    • Resistance between C and R (working): 10–20 Ohm.
    • Between S and R there should be a total resistance (30–60 Ohms).
  • If at least one value is “0” or “∞”, the winding is burned out.
  • In 30% of cases the compressor does not work due to breakdown of the starting relay (cost: 500–1200 rub.). You can replace it yourself, but you will need a specialist to repair the motor. Average prices for work in 2026:

    • 🔧 Replacement of the compressor: 4000–7000 rubles. (without the cost of the part).
    • 🔄 Refilling with freon: 2500–4000 rubles.
    • 🔥 Repair of windings: 3000–5000 rubles. (not always advisable).
    ⚠️ Attention: In refrigerators with inverter compressor (Panasonic NR-BN30A1, Hitachi R-BG410P6) you cannot use conventional starting relays! They require specialized parts that are selected according to the model.
    What to do if the compressor hums but does not start?

    This is a sign interturn short circuit or piston wedge. Do not try to turn on the refrigerator again - this may cause the windings to catch fire. Immediately disconnect it from the network and call a specialist.

    5. Freon leak: how to detect and what to do

    Freon is a refrigerant that circulates through the system and cools the chambers. If it leaks (for example, due to corrosion of tubes or mechanical damage), the freezer stops freezingand the compressor is idling. Signs of a leak:

    • ❄️ The condenser (grid at the back) remains cold even after an hour of operation.
    • 🔊 The compressor works without stopping, but the temperature does not drop.
    • 💨 An oily stain is visible at the leak site (usually on the bends of the tubes).
    • 🛠️ On some models (Liebherr CNef 4315) an error light comes up F5 or AL02.

    How to find leak:

    1. Unplug the refrigerator and inspect the pipes for corrosion or cracks.
    2. Apply soap solution to suspicious areas - if there is a leak, bubbles will appear.
    3. Use Freon leak detector (can be rented for 500–800 rub./day).

    Solution:

    • 🔧 Small leak (for example, at the soldering point): you can solder it yourself using a torch and solder (tin + flux for copper).
    • 🚫 Corrosion of pipes: a section of the system will need to be replaced. The service will cost 3000–6000 rubles.
    • 🔄 After eliminating the leak be sure to refill freon (cost: 1500–3000 rubles depending on the type of refrigerant).

    In refrigerators No Frost leaks often occur in evaporator (hidden behind the panel). To get to it, you will have to defrost the unit and remove the internal lining of the freezer.

    6. Failure of the No Frost system: why the fan freezes

    In refrigerators with the system No Frost (Samsung RL34ECBP, Indesit ITF 118 W) the fan is responsible for cooling, which drives cold air through the chambers. If it freezes or breaks, the freezer stops freezingand the refrigerator compartment can continue to work. Reasons:

    • ❄️ Icing of the evaporator due to a faulty defrost sensor or Heating element.
    • 🔌 Failure of the fan motor (often in models LG GA-B489YQZL after 5–7 years of operation).
    • 🧊 Clogging drainage holeleading to the accumulation of condensate.

    How to diagnose:

    1. Unplug the refrigerator and defrost it for 12-24 hours.
    2. Remove the back panel in the freezer (usually secured with 4-6 screws).
    3. Check whether the fan rotates manually. If not, the motor is burned out.
    4. Inspect the evaporator: if it is covered with ice, the problem is in the defrosting system.

    Solution:

    • 🔧 Fan replacement: the part costs 1500–3000 rubles, the work costs 2000–3500 rubles.
    • 🔥 Replacing the defrosting heating element: 1000–2500 rub. (depending on the model).
    • 🧹 Cleaning the drainage: you can do it yourself using wire and warm water.

    In refrigerators Full No Frost (for example Liebherr CN 4015) there is one fan for both cameras. If it breaks, the refrigerator compartment will also stop working.

    7. Electronic control module: when the refrigerator is “glitchy”

    In modern refrigerators (Samsung RL60T671CS8, LG GB-B539SLQZ), an electronic board is responsible for all processes. If it fails, the symptoms can be very different:

    • 📛 Errors appear on the display E3, F7, AL04 (see the instructions for decoding).
    • 🔄 The compressor turns on for 5-10 seconds and turns off.
    • 🌡️ The temperature in the freezer jumps from -20°C to +10°C for no reason.
    • 🔌 The refrigerator does not respond to button presses.

    Causes of board failure:

    • ⚡ Power surge in the network (especially important for houses with old wiring).
    • 💦 Ingress of moisture (for example, during defrosting).
    • 🕰️ Natural wear and tear (board service life: 7–10 years).

    Independent repair is only possible if:

    • 🔧 The fuse on the board has blown (can be replaced with a soldering iron).
    • 🧹 The contacts have oxidized (wipe with alcohol).
    • 🔄 The firmware has been lost (on some models Samsung it can be restored via service menu).

    In other cases, the board will need to be replaced (cost: 5,000–12,000 rubles, depending on the model). For refrigerators Bosch and Siemens sometimes it helps resetting the settings:

    1. Unplug the refrigerator for 1 minute.
    

    2. Turn on and immediately press the combination:

    - For Bosch KGN39XL30R: "Freezer" + "SuperCool" (hold 5 seconds).

    - For Siemens KG39NXI35R: «Frigo» + «Freezer» (hold 10 sec).

    3. Wait for the beep and reboot.

    ⚠️ Attention: If the control board has failed due to a power surge, check stabilizer or surge filter. Without them, modern electronically controlled refrigerators will last no more than 3–5 years.

    The refrigerator hums, but does not freeze. What to check?

    Most likely, the problem is in one of three components:

    1. The compressor is working. idle (no refrigerant or clogged capillary).
    2. The starting relay is broken —the compressor tries to start, but cannot.
    3. The thermostat is faulty —it does not give a signal for cooling.

    The first thing to do is to touch the condenser (the grill at the back). If it is cold, there is a freon leak or a blockage. If it is hot, there is a problem with the compressor or relay.
